Games like Shining Force?
So I haven't paid too much attention to the gaming industry in the last 10 years or so, but in the last few months I've received a PS3 and a Wii as gifts. I don't have tons of time or money to play games, but I'm really wanting to get my hands on a strategy rpg in the same vein as Shining Force. I loved the Shining Force series, because it was simple, yet had a lot of depth. I'd love it if Sega would re-release part 3 in its complete form someday.
Anyways, are there any games out there that are similar? I'm aware of Valkyria Chronicles and plan on getting it. I was also considering downloading Final Fantasy Tactics (I never played it), but I've heard it has a pretty steep learning curve which I don't know if I have the time to devote.
Anything else I should take a look at?

Re: Games like Shining Force?
Disgaea.
Final Fantasy Tactics is a no-brainer. Pretty sure it's on PSN for $10.
If you have a DS, any and all Advance Wars and Fire Emblems are good. Several are for GBA. Advance Wars isn't a fantasy story, but I love the tactics. Wii and Gamecube also both got a good Fire Emblem.
Also, both Shining Forces are on the PS3 Sega Genesis Collection, which goes for $20-30 and both are on the Wii Virtual Console.

Re: Games like Shining Force?
On the Wii, you have Fire Emblem, and there is a Gamecube fire emblem game that is playable on the wii. I think there's a Sakura Taisen game coming out soon, and while I haven't seen this new game I think that's always been a strategy staple. Phantom Brave is also out, but is pretty complex.
There are a few PS1 games, not sure how readily available they are. I really really liked Brigandine.
You'll find that portable systems have a ton of these kinds of games:
PSP: Joan of Arc: this game is a pretty simple strategy game in terms of units, but is still great. I think it reminds me most of Shining Force. FF Tactics is also on this system, as is Disgaea 1 and 2.
GBA: Shining Force 1 and 2, Advance Wars 1 and 2, Super Robot Wars 1 and 2
DS: the DS is literally overloaded with these games, and there is a Shining Force game coming out for it. Luminous Arc 1 and 2 are pretty simple (almost too simple for me). Final Fantasy Tactics A2, Shin Megami Tensei Devil Summoner, Rondo of Swords, Knights in the Knightmare, Disgaea DS, Drone Tactics, Advance Wars DS, Fire Emblem DS, Blue Dragon Plus, Hoshigami, and I'm sure there are a ton more that I don't recall off the top of my head.

Re: Games like Shining Force?
I don't know if you can find it, but I thought the first Vandal Hearts game for PS1 played a lot like Shining Force (with an added bonus of Monty-Python-like fountains of blood).
